Dutch Bros Coffee deeply invests in the development and well-being of its employees. The company offers numerous benefits such as paid volunteer time, a comprehensive Employee Assistance Program, and educational benefits providing up to $5,250 per year for professional growth after one year of employment. The onboarding process includes extensive training to ensure Broistas have the tools and knowledge needed to succeed in their roles. Additionally, Dutch Bros Caring culture extends to its physical and mental health support systems, robust recognition programs, and a competitive compensation package which includes hourly pay plus tips. The environment is designed to be inclusive, supportive, and motivating, encouraging employees to bring their best selves to work every day.
Working at Dutch Bros Coffee also comes with unique physical and procedural expectations. Team members need to be prepared for a fast-paced work setting that can involve standing for extended periods, handling physical tasks like lifting up to 65 pounds, and working in varying weather conditions with appropriate gear provided. The company emphasizes strict adherence to its policies and procedures, including obtaining and maintaining a Food Handler Permit or Certification where required, and passing necessary training programs for continual compliance and quality assurance. Furthermore, solid communication skills in English are required, and the ability to communicate in additional languages is highly valued.
Compensation for this position can go up to $16.00 per hour, including an average tip of $6.00 per hour.
